Ok, so today we did a stand alone message called "Three Words That Change Everything!" This was definitely a message that could change everything in our church! Scott really did an amazing job of not beating around the bush and really speaking truth to our community of people at Resonate. The basics of the message was about commitment and was based on the lack of commitment we see as well as a strong word we heard from Craig Groeschel (LifeChurch.tv) at the Nation New Church Convention this year.

Scott talked about three chairs that people sit in with Christianity! The first chair was "The Condemned Chair". The people in the condemned chair have no relationship with Jesus. The next chair and probably most common chair of all is "The Convenience Chair". These are the people that want a relationship with Jesus based on what they can get from it. At some point these people will say "I'll follow you Jesus until you say something that I don't like and then when that happens I'm done!" The people in this chair are worse than "The Condemned Chair"! "The Convenience Chair" people only come to church when it is convenient for them to come. They skip out when we are talking about tough issues or topics because they don't want to hear where they are wrong! These people put everything else above Jesus a majority of the time. Kids sports, kids in general and many other things. The next chair is "The Contribution Chair". These people want the gold star just because they serve and show up! They don't really want to truly pick up their cross daily and live for Him they way He wants us to. The feel good enough about what they are doing just because they show up! The fourth and last chair is "The Crucified Chair". This is the only chair that Jesus wants!!! Those who are willing to count the cost and say the three words that change everything... "God I'm Yours!". Every area of their life is in response to God and nothing is more important. These are the disciples that we want to create here at Resonate! People who are willing to say, "God, I'm Yours! Everything, every area of my heart!".
